Archana Turaga is a financial advisor at Summitry, LLC with Series 65 credentials and five years of industry experience. Prior to joining Summitry in 2021, she worked at Aspiriant LLC, Yellow Brick Road Financial Advisors LLC, and Carlton Pace Wealth Management. Summitry provides discretionary portfolio management and financial planning services to individuals, high-net-worth clients, and institutional investors. The firm employs a research-driven investment approach focused on bottom-up valuation analysis and offers internally managed strategies as well as manager selection and separately managed account relationships.

Standalone financial planning fees range from $1,500 to $5,000 depending on scope and complexity
$0 - $2,500,000: 1.25% annually $2,500,001 - $5,000,000: 1.00% annually $5,000,001 - $10,000,000: 0.75% annually $10,000,001+: 0.625% annually
Account minimum: $1,000,000 Minimum fee: May assess a minimum annual fee of $5,000 for ongoing asset management services
